Roof Damage Inspection Services
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. Trained professionals examine the roof’s surface, checking for signs of wear, leaks, missing or damaged shingles, and other structural concerns. These inspections often include evaluating the condition of flashing, gutters, and ventilation components to ensure the roof’s integrity. The goal is to detect problems early, before they lead to more extensive damage or costly repairs, providing property owners with a clear understanding of their roof’s current condition.
This service helps address common roofing problems such as leaks, water intrusion,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Identifying these issues early can prevent further damage to the interior of a building, including ceilings, walls, and insulation. Regular roof inspections are especially useful after severe weather events like storms or heavy winds, which can cause hidden or visible damage. By pinpointing vulnerabilities, property owners can prioritize repairs and maintenance, potentially extending the lifespan of their roofing system and avoiding unexpected expenses.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Montclair,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Costs - The cost for a roof damage inspection typically 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her fees.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Assessment Fees - Assessment fees for roof damage evaluations usually fall between $100 and $300. These fees cover the inspection process and initial damage assessment, with prices varying by location and roof type. Some providers may include a report or consultation in the fee.
Additional Charges - Additional costs may apply if extensive damage is found, such as $200 to $600 for repairs or further evaluation. Factors influencing costs include roof accessibility, height, and extent of damage. Local service providers can clarify potential extra charges during contact.
Cost Variations - Cost ranges for roof damage inspections can vary widely based on regional factors, roof size, and inspection scope. Typical prices in Montclair, NJ, and nearby areas are within the $150 to $400 range. Pros can offer tailored estimates after initial contact and assessment.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What does a roof damage inspection include? A roof damage inspection typically involves a visual assessment of the roof's surface, checking for missing or damaged shingles, leaks, and other signs of wear or deterioration that could indicate underlying issues.
How can I tell if my roof has damage? Signs of roof damage may include water stains on ceilings, missing shingles, visible sagging, or granules from shingles in gutters. A professional inspection can identify issues that may not be immediately visible.
How often should I have my roof in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spection after severe weather events, or at least once a year to ensure early detection of potential problems.
Why is a professional roof damage inspection important? A professional inspection helps identify hidden damage, prevent future issues, and maintain the integrity of the roof, potentially saving money on costly repairs.
